Skittle, glitter and stamping - a very spring themed manicure


Since the sun was out again, I felt drawn to the neons and pastels in my stash, and chose three complimenting polishes - lavender, neon mint and light dusty blue. I started by painting my nails with the base colours of my chosen polishes, and then added a coat of the gorgeous glitter topper from Claire's. I really love how it looks over the neon green and the lavender. The whole thing still looked unfinished, so I added some floral stamping with MoYou London Mother Nature 02 plate and my trusty Stargazer 232 silver chrome.

I really like the partial coverage stamping achieved with the full image plate from MoYou London
Because Mother Nature plates are all full pattern ones, I was able to stamp different sections of the floral pattern onto my nails, and have the stamps cover only some of my nail.

Polishes I used:
  • Nails Inc York Street - dusty pale blue crème, opaque in two coats and reasonably quick to dry. A bit patchy on the first coat, but completely self-leveling on the second one.
  • Nails Inc Wardour Street - beautiful lavender crème, super easy to apply and opaque in two coats. My new favourite purple.
  • Claire's Shiver- a glitter topper of white and semi-translucent green hexes in a shimmery base that flashes blue, pink and purple. I wasn't able to fully capture the shimmer in the sunlight over the bright undies - but it's there. This glitter is very easy to apply, dries fast and to a slightly rough finish. Great polish from a budget brand!
  • China Glaze Highlight of my Summer - neon mint crème, much brighter than my photos show it to be. It was a nightmare to apply - patchy, streaky and uneven; needed three coats for full opacity and dried uneven. The glitter and top coat solved most of the problems with the finish, so in the end, it's worth the bother.
  • Stargazer 232 - seriously silver chrome, perfect for stamping.
